引言

在数字货币迅速发展的今天,区块链钱包的重要性愈发凸显。它不仅是用户存储和管理数字资产的工具,同时也是与区块链网络进行交互的桥梁。搭建自己的区块链钱包服务器虽然具备一定的技术门槛,但通过本文的详细介绍,您将能够分步骤了解如何搭建一个安全且高效的区块链钱包服务器,以更好地管理您的数字资产。

第一部分:选择合适的区块链钱包类型

如何搭建区块链钱包的服务器:详尽指南

在搭建区块链钱包服务器之前,首先需要明确的是选择何种类型的区块链钱包。常见的区块链钱包主要分为以下几类:

  • 热钱包:热钱包是指常在线的钱包,适合进行频繁交易。其优点是便捷,但相对安全性低。
  • 冷钱包:冷钱包是离线存储的方式,安全性高,适合长期保存大额数字资产,但操作不便。
  • 硬件钱包:这类钱包因使用物理设备存储私钥而安全性很高,适合高净值用户。

各类型钱包有其独特优势,用户应根据自己的需求选择适合的类型。

第二部分:准备服务器环境

搭建区块链钱包服务器的第一步就是选择一个合适的服务器。以下是一些推荐的步骤:

  1. 选择云服务器:推荐使用如AWS、Google Cloud、阿里云等提供商的云服务器。
  2. 服务器配置:根据钱包软件的需求,选择适合的配置。在内存、 CPU 和空间上提供足够的资源。
  3. 操作系统:Linux是最常用的操作系统,推荐使用Ubuntu或CentOS。
  4. 网络安全:确保您服务器的网络配置安全,尽量使用VPN、SSH密钥等方式进行安全连接。

第三部分:安装钱包软件

如何搭建区块链钱包的服务器:详尽指南

在确保服务器环境准备妥当后,接下来便是安装钱包软件。选择合适的区块链钱包软件至关重要。您可以选择开源软件如 Bitcoin Core、Ethereum Geth等,也可以选择更为封闭的商业软件。以下以Ethereum钱包为例进行简要说明:

  1. 下载并安装:从官方渠道下载对应版本的Geth。
  2. 初始化:通过命令行工具进行初始化,设置数据目录与网络信息。
  3. 同步区块:为了使用钱包功能,需要将区块同步至本地,这个过程可能耗时较长。

第四部分:钱包安全性设置

安全性问题是区块链钱包搭建过程中非常重要的一环。为了保护您的数字资产,应采取多重安全措施:

  • 私钥管理:私钥是访问数字资产的唯一凭证,绝对不能泄露。在服务器上推荐使用硬件加密模块来保存私钥。
  • 备份:定期进行钱包备份,包括链数据和私钥,防止数据丢失。
  • 多重身份验证:比如使用2FA增加登陆安全性。
  • 定期更新:保持钱包软件的更新,以防止安全漏洞被利用。

第五部分:维护和监控

钱包搭建完成后,并不意味着任务结束。持续的维护和监控是确保钱包安全及功能正常运行的必要措施:

  • 定期检查:定期检查钱包的运行状态,确保没有出现异常。
  • 监控攻击:利用监控软件或服务来检测潜在的攻击迹象。
  • 用户反馈:如果设有用户界面,应定期收集用户的反馈以用户体验。

常见问题解答

如何选择合适的区块链钱包软件?

选择区块链钱包软件时,要考虑以下几个因素:

  • 资产支持:确保钱包支持您所持有的数字货币种类。
  • 社区和开发者支持:选择那些有活跃社区和开发者维护的钱包。
  • 安全性:找寻那些有良好安全性记录的软件,查看是否经历过较大的安全事件。

此外,开源软件为用户提供了更高的透明性。与封闭软件相比,开源钱包能够让用户更方便的检查其代码,增强信任度。

如何确保区块链钱包的安全性?

确保区块链钱包的安全性,用户可以采取以下措施:

  • 离线保存私钥:尽量将私钥保存到离线冷钱包中,降低被黑客攻击的风险。
  • 启用多重身份验证:使用双因素身份验证(2FA)可大幅提高安全性。
  • 安装防病毒软件:防止恶意软件窃取用户信息。

同时,用户还应定期更新钱包软件,以确保修补任何已知漏洞,提升安全水平。

如何备份区块链钱包?

备份区块链钱包是保护数字资产的重要步骤,通常涉及以下操作:

  • 备份私钥:使用可靠的工具导出私钥,并在安全的位置进行存储。
  • 备份钱包文件:定期对整个钱包的数据进行备份。
  • 使用冷存储:建议将备份存储在安全的物理地点,如USB存储器或纸质形式。

备份的频率最好根据钱包的使用频率合理设置,确保每次重要操作后都进行备份。

如何处理区块链钱包的技术故障?

在使用区块链钱包的过程中,可能会遇到技术故障,处理方法主要包括:

  • 查阅文档:大多数钱包软件都提供详细的文档,可以帮助用户解决常见问题。
  • 社区支持:参与相关的论坛、社区,咨询其他用户的建议和经验。
  • 联系客服:如果是商业软件,可以通过其客服渠道联系寻求专业的技术支持。

保持耐心,逐步排查故障原因,确保按步骤进行修复,避免因急躁导致误操作。

区块链钱包的未来趋势是什么?

区块链钱包的未来趋势主要包括以下几个方面:

  • 用户体验:随着用户群体的扩大,钱包提供商将更加关注用户体验,以简化操作流程。
  • 多元化支持:未来的钱包可能将支持更多的数字资产,并具备跨链交易功能。
  • 安全技术创新:随着网络安全威胁的增加,钱包开发者将持续创新,提供更高效的安全保护技术。

总体来看,区块链钱包将朝着安全、效率与便利并存的方向发展,以满足用户不断变化的需求。

总结

搭建区块链钱包的服务器虽然初期具有一定的技术门槛,但通过本文的详细步骤及常见问题解答,希望您能够对区块链钱包的搭建和使用有更全面的认识。在此过程中,请牢记安全性的重要性,同时也要持续关注区块链技术的发展,以便于在未来更好的管理和使用您的数字资产。